DESCRIPTION


A government authority in Charleston, West Virginia is seeking a qualified vendor to provide professional audit services. The selected firm will prepare an Audit Report containing all required financial statements, notes, analyses, and reports in accordance with Governmental Auditing Standards for proprietary funds engaged in business-type activities.

The auditor will be responsible for following up on prior audit findings, assessing the reasonableness of the summary schedule of prior findings, and reporting instances where the schedule materially misrepresents the status of any audit issues. The audit is set to commence on a mutually agreed date after June 30 of each year. Additionally, auditors are expected to hold entrance conferences with staff and key board members to discuss audit procedures, logistics, and potential concerns prior to the engagement.
